Finding the right healthy and satisfying snacks can be a challenge when it comes to weight loss. Nuts are an excellent option, providing essential nutrients, healthy fats, and a feeling of fullness that can help curb overeating. In this guide, we’ll explore the benefits of nuts for weight loss and identify the best nuts to eat for weight loss.

Best Nuts to Eat for Weight Loss

  • Almonds

Almonds are among the best nuts to include in a weight-loss diet. Studies have shown that almonds can help decrease belly fat and improve overall body composition. Additionally, their high fiber content aids digestion and promotes a healthy gut.

  • Walnuts

Walnuts are another perfect choice for weight loss. They are high in omega-3 fatty acids, linked to reduced inflammation and improved heart health. Walnuts also contain a unique type of fat called alpha-linolenic acid (ALA), which has been shown to support weight loss and fat metabolism.

  • Pistachios

Pistachios are not solely delicious but also beneficial for weight loss. They are lower in calories than many other nuts, making them a great option for calorie-conscious individuals. The shelling pistachios can also slow your eating pace, allowing you to eat more mindfully and recognize when you’re full. Moreover, pistachios are rich in protein and fiber, which can help curb appetite and promote satiety.

  • Cashews

Cashews are a creamy and satisfying nut that can be a worthwhile addition to a weight loss diet. They are a good source of magnesium, which is essential for energy exhibition and muscle function. Cashews also contain healthy fats and protein, helping satisfy you and preventing overeating. Their slightly sweet flavor makes them a great alternative to sugary snacks, helping to reduce sugar cravings.

  • Pecans

Pecans are a flavorsome and nutritious nut that can aid in weight loss. They are high in monounsaturated fats, which have been shown to support heart health and weight management. Pecans also provide a good amount of fiber, promoting digestion and helping to control hunger. Including pecans in your diet can help satisfy your sweet tooth without consuming unhealthy, high-calorie desserts.

Tips for Incorporating Nuts into Your Diet

  • Mindful Eating: Practice mindful eating by focusing on your hunger and fullness cues. Nuts are calorie-dense, so it’s important to enjoy them in moderation. Measure a serving size to avoid overeating, and savor each bite to appreciate the flavor and texture fully.
  • Pair with Fruits or Vegetables: Pairing nuts with fruits or vegetables can create a balanced and satisfying snack. For example, enjoy a handful of almonds with an apple or mix walnuts into a salad for added crunch and nutrition. Combining nuts with other whole foods can enhance their benefits and provide a more filling snack.
  • Use as a Topping: Incorporate nuts into your meals as a topping for yogurt, oatmeal, or smoothie bowls. This adds texture and flavor while boosting the nutritional content of your meals. Experiment with different types of nuts to see your favorite combinations.
  • Avoid Salted or Flavored Nuts: Opt for raw or lightly roasted nuts without added salt or flavors. Salted or flavored nuts can contain added sugars and unhealthy fats that counteract the nuts’ benefits. Choosing plain nuts ensures you’re getting the most natural and healthful option.


Nuts are a valuable addition to any weight loss diet, offering a combination of nutrients, healthy fats, and satiety that can help you achieve your goals. By incorporating almonds, walnuts, pistachios, cashews, and pecans into your diet, you can enjoy a variety of flavors and health advantages while supporting your weight loss journey. Remember to practice mindful eating and enjoy nuts in moderation to maximize their benefits.


